Engine BlockThe engine block is the heart of the Dodge Ram, forming the structure that houses the cylinders, pistons, and other vital components. Made from cast iron or aluminum, the block needs to endure intense heat and pressure during operation. Regular evaluation for fractures or wear can prevent costly repair work.

PistonsPistons go up and down within the cylinders, driven by the combustion of fuel. They play a substantial function in generating power and should be robust to withstand severe conditions. Signs of piston wear can consist of oil intake or loss of power.

CrankshaftThe crankshaft transforms the linear movement of the pistons into rotational movement. It should be balanced exactly to ensure smooth engine operation. Vibration or knocking noises can signal a stopping working crankshaft.

CamshaftThe camshaft manages the opening and closing of the engine valves. In contemporary Dodge Rams, this part is frequently variable to enhance engine efficiency and fuel effectiveness.

Timing Belt/ChainThis part integrates the crankshaft and camshaft, guaranteeing that the engine's valves open and close at the correct times during each cylinder's intake and exhaust strokes. Regularly inspecting the timing belt for wear can avoid engine failure.

Oil PumpThe oil pump is important for keeping lubrication throughout the engine, ensuring that all moving parts receive appropriate oil supply. A stopping working oil pump can result in catastrophic engine damage.

Fuel InjectorsFuel injectors deliver the accurate quantity of fuel into the combustion chamber. A blocked injector can cause engine misfires and reduced performance.

Ignition SystemThis system includes spark plugs and coils that fire up the fuel-air mixture. Routine maintenance of these parts can enhance fuel economy and efficiency.

Exhaust ManifoldThe exhaust manifold gathers exhaust gases from the engine cylinders and directs them to the exhaust system. Any leaks can substantially impact engine efficiency and emissions.
Upkeep Tips for Dodge Ram Engine Parts
Efficient upkeep is essential for ensuring the durability and reliability of [Dodge Ram Parts Catalog](https://notes.io/edBdL) Ram engine parts. Here are some crucial maintenance pointers:
Maintenance Checklist
Routine Oil Changes
Change oil every 5,000-7,500 miles.Use manufacturer-recommended oil type.
Evaluation of Belts and Chains
Inspect for wear and stress every 10,000 miles.Replace timing belts according to the service manual.
Keeping An Eye On Fluid Levels
Check coolant, oil, and transmission fluid levels regularly.
Air Filter Replacement
Change air filters every 15,000-30,000 miles to guarantee ideal air flow to the engine.
Fuel System Cleaning
Carry out a fuel system cleaning every 30,000 miles to avoid injector clogging.
Stimulate Plug Inspection
Change stimulate plugs every 30,000-100,000 miles depending on the type utilized.When to Replace Engine Parts
Comprehending when to change engine components can conserve money and time. Here are some indications that indicate it's time for a replacement:
Signs for ReplacementOil Leaks: Persistent leakages can signal a stopping working gasket or oil pump.Unusual Noises: Knocking or grinding sounds may show issues with the crankshaft or pistons.Poor Performance: Decreased power or velocity could connect to malfunctioning injectors, stimulate plugs, or air filters.Engine Overheating: This can represent a failing oil pump or coolant system issues.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)1.
